Democratic Tennessee Rep. Steve Cohen remarked on CNN Wednesday that the United States needs “better Supreme Court judges” to make decisions on the Second Amendment.

WATCH:

CNN host Wolf Blitzer asked, “Do you think the Second Amendment to the Constitution should be repealed?”

“We need better Supreme Court judges who can interpret the Second Amendment in a way that is in keeping with what the American people want,” Cohen answered. “You know, I think that there’s a right to bear arms of individuals to protect their homes, and I passed a right to carry bill when I was a state senator because people ought to have a right to protect their home.”

“But there are reasonable restrictions that can be placed on the purchase of weapons like AR-15s and AK-47s. And, that’s been the case through history. Sawed off shotguns were not allowed since 1938, and even in the Heller decision of 2008, which was awful, in a 5-4 decision, the Supreme Court said that there could be restrictions,” he said.

“So no, I think the Supreme Court needs better justices who interpret the Second Amendment in the way it should be interpreted, which is kind of what Justice Stevens says. It was for a well-regulated militia, but it won’t be repealed and it’s a political issue. This is one place where President Trump is right about the law–even a blind squirrel finds an acorn once in a while.”
